The Airbus A320-214 belongs to the A320 family, occupying the single-aisle, 150–180 seat market niche with efficient short- to medium-haul performance and commonality benefits across the type. Powered by two CFM56-5B4/P engines each rated at 27,000 lbf, the type competes directly with variants of the Boeing 737 family for airline and charter buyers. For a 2006-build airframe like N297NV, key resale and leasing considerations include remaining airframe fatigue life, CFM56 engine shop visit status, and cabin refurbishment to contemporary passenger expectations; trust ownership can simplify transfer or remarketing but may require active management to return the aircraft to service.
